Output 11395065f6d99b56605cf40e332a99ac536e972a24fbd4306ee4b5bcd7d5f269:1

value
7591089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c63b285be516e6234ad13a5f5167bb3345570d4d OP_EQUALVERIFY OP_CHECKSIG
address
1K59fL2vTdvQMbetJPYRgy1BcEniazdEGf
transaction
11395065f6d99b56605cf40e332a99ac536e972a24fbd4306ee4b5bcd7d5f269
spent
true